信息系统安全漏洞是网络安全领域中的常见问题,它可能来源于软件、硬件、网络配置等多方面。本文将深入探讨信息系统安全漏洞的修补方案,旨在帮助读者全面了解漏洞修补的关键步骤与策略。
一、漏洞修复的重要性
随着信息技术的快速发展,信息系统在各个领域中的应用越来越广泛。然而,随之而来的安全风险也在不断增大。及时修复信息系统中的安全漏洞,对于保障数据安全和系统稳定至关重要。
1.1 防止数据泄露
安全漏洞可能导致敏感数据泄露,给企业和个人带来严重损失。
1.2 避免服务中断
未修复的漏洞可能导致系统崩溃,影响正常业务运营。
1.3 降低攻击风险
及时修复漏洞可以降低系统遭受恶意攻击的风险。
二、漏洞修复流程
漏洞修复流程主要包括以下七个步骤:
2.1 漏洞发现
漏洞发现可以通过以下途径实现:
- 安全研究人员
- 白帽黑客
- 自动化扫描工具
2.2 漏洞评估
根据漏洞的严重性级别(如紧急、高、中、低)进行评估。
2.3 漏洞通报
向受影响的软件供应商或开源项目团队报告发现的漏洞。
2.4 补丁开发
供应商或社区开发者针对特定漏洞编写修复代码。
2.5 测试与验证
在发布补丁前进行全面测试,确保不会引入新的问题。
2.6 补丁部署
用户根据官方指南安装补丁以关闭安全缺口。
2.7 后续监控
持续跟踪已修复漏洞的状态,确保没有遗漏任何实例。
三、常见漏洞类型及其影响
3.1 SQL注入
攻击者通过构造恶意SQL语句执行非法操作,可能导致数据泄露、数据库损坏。
3.2 跨站脚本攻击(XSS)
在网页中插入恶意脚本,当其他用户访问时自动运行,可能窃取cookies、会话劫持。
3.3 缓冲区溢出
程序试图向固定长度的空间写入更多数据导致溢出,可能导致远程代码执行、系统崩溃。
3.4 权限提升
利用系统漏洞获得更高级别的访问权限,可能完全控制系统、安装后门。
四、如何有效实施漏洞修复
4.1 建立漏洞修复机制
制定漏洞修复流程,明确责任人和时间节点。
4.2 加强安全意识培训
提高员工对安全漏洞的认识,增强安全防护意识。
4.3 定期进行安全检查
定期对信息系统进行安全检查,及时发现并修复漏洞。
4.4 使用漏洞扫描工具
利用漏洞扫描工具自动发现系统中的安全漏洞。
4.5 建立安全漏洞知识库
收集整理已知的漏洞信息,为漏洞修复提供参考。
4.6 及时更新补丁
及时安装官方发布的补丁,修复已知漏洞。
五、总结
信息系统安全漏洞的修复是一项长期而复杂的工作。通过建立完善的漏洞修复机制,加强安全意识培训,定期进行安全检查,使用漏洞扫描工具,建立安全漏洞知识库,及时更新补丁等措施,可以有效降低信息系统安全风险,保障数据安全和系统稳定。
